Other Social Sciences is the 182nd most popular major in the country with 2,414 degrees awarded in 2020-2021. In 2019-2020, other social sciences graduates who were awarded their degree in 2017-2019, earned an average of $35,015 and had an average of $23,193 in loans still to pay off.

Out of the 2 schools in the Schools Highly Focused on Other Social Sciences Major in Louisiana that were part of this year’s ranking, Tulane University of Louisiana landed the #1 spot on the list. Tulane is located in New Orleans, Louisiana and, has a fairly large student population. In 2020-2021, this school awarded 14 ’s other social sciences degrees to qualified students.
Since the school has a undergrad student-to-faculty ratio of 8 to 1, those pursuing a degree will have more opportunities to interact with their professors. The school has an excellent freshman retention rate of 92%, which means students like the school well enough to return for a second year. The school has an impressive undergrad student loan default rate. It’s only 3.1%, which is much lower than the national rate of 10.1%.
